We have an exciting new opportunity for a Reliability/Maintenance Data Analyst to join the Tip Top team. Reporting to the National Reliability Manager this role is responsible to provide analytics and insights to the site reliability teams to improve maintenance planning, spares availability and minimize downtime. This role is flexible to be based at our Chullora NSW, Dandenong VIC or Springwood QLD site.
Purpose of the Role
- Support sites to ensure all required data is captured within MEX to drive the KPIs set out, including PM Completion rate, Cost of downtime
- Analyse outputs from OFS, MEX and other systems to drive insights to the site teams to improve reliability and work planning
- Partner with Supply Chain and Operations to understand the impact of upcoming work and communicate effectively to minimise disruptions
- Provide data support to the reliability teams to drive inventory and work order management, preventative maintenance scheduling and MAI reporting
- Assist in investigation and sharing of RCAs on all major breakdowns
- Establish asset master data, including asset criticality, work priority, and failure codes with support from the reliability engineering function
- Perform asset data integrity health checks
- Prepare reports, presentations and develop recommendations for improved asset reliability
